Transportation Engineer 4/Temporary Traffic Control & Signals Staff Specialist, PN 20065794
The State of Ohio is seeking a Transportation Engineer 4/Temporary Traffic Control & Signals Staff Specialist to join their Transportation - Central Office team. The role involves acting as a specialist in the Office of Roadway Engineering, reviewing and updating Work Zone Standards, and completing field reviews of work zones.
